South Africa - Import of Bovine, Sheep and Goat Fats
Since 2014, South Africa Import of Bovine, Sheep and Goat Fats increased 8.5% year on year. With $7,453,678.54 in 2019, the country was number 26 comparing other countries in Import of Bovine, Sheep and Goat Fats. South Africa is overtaken by South Korea, which was number 25 at $7,973,741.24 and is followed by Turkey at $7,006,456.68. Singapore lead the ranking with $268,937,837.58 in 2019, +28.9% compared to 2018. Mexico, Belgium and United States resp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Latvia witnessed the best average annual growth at +411.5% per year, while Costa Rica witnessed the worst performance at -87.8% per year.

Date | US Dollars |
---|---|
2019 | 7,453,678.54 |
2018 | 8,330,045.50 |
2017 | 7,520,428.00 |
2016 | 3,732,586.00 |
2015 | 2,627,818.25 |
